2011 Test Scores

The Florida Comprehensive Assessment Test®, also known as FCAT, is a standardized test given annually to students in primary and secondary schools (grades 3-11) in the state of Florida. FCAT assesses students' knowledge in reading, math, science and writing.

The charts below show the percentage of students at Arlington Middle School that met the state of Florida standards.

16:1
Student-Teacher Ratio
(878 students - 57 teachers)

Arlington Middle School has 16 students for every one full-time equivalent teacher (SOURCE: NCES, 2008-2009).

Florida student-teacher ratio (avg): 15:1
U.S. student-teacher ratio (avg): 15:1
